Originally Posted by JustAnotherPLT
For those of you with interviews soon, something you might want to ask is what side of the fence will they be placing you? How will your seniority be determined before and post integration? I'm curious as to how they are going to start filling positions. Some mentioned that ASA is properly staffed, I disagree. The picture has changed and staffing also needs to reflect XJT side and some have mentioned understaffed over there. ASA side is short FOs and properly staffed on CA.
Why would a new hire want to ask about how their seniority will be integrated? Either way they're on the bottom of the integrated list as new hires. The last true ASA class was Nov 1st and they all got ATL CRJ. From now on the new hires could goto any of the bases. Makes choosing the new ASA a bigger decision but they should be able to give you a good idea before taking the job.
